What is Sociality.io?
Sociality.io provides brands and agencies with a unified social media management platform supporting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, TikTok, and YouTube. Teams can schedule posts and Stories, reply to DMs and comments, pull analytics, and benchmark competitors across the same networks inside one calendar. The platform offers real-time presence indicators, approval workflows, and activity logs to keep teams aligned and accountable.
Core Capabilities
- Unified publishing calendar: Schedule posts, Stories, Reels across multiple social networks
- Engagement management: Centralize replies to DMs, comments, and messages
- Analytics and reporting: Track KPIs and generate custom reports
- Competitor benchmarking: Monitor competitor performance and trends
- Team collaboration: Unlimited workspaces, role-based permissions (admin, editor, moderator, read-only)
- API integration: Enterprise plans support API access
Pros
- 30-minute human support response time, 7 days a week
- Report generation reduced from a full day to 15 minutes
- Real-time presence indicators prevent content clashes
- ISO-certified Google Cloud London data centers with encryption in transit and at rest
- 14-day free trial, no credit card required
Cons
- Pricing tiered by profiles and users, starting at $99/month for smaller teams
- Focused on mainstream social platforms, not all emerging networks
- Advanced API access limited to enterprise plans
- Learning curve may require dedicated onboarding support
Decision Guidance
Use Sociality.io when: Your marketing team, agency, or brand needs a unified platform to manage multiple social accounts, automate scheduling, centralize engagement, and generate reports. Especially suited for organizations that value fast support response and team collaboration.
Consider alternatives if: You manage only 1-2 social accounts, have a tight budget, or need deep integration with niche platforms—lighter or specialized tools may fit better.
